I found myself in a similar position last year. Two days prior to match day I was offered the chance to interview for my dream job. I went through the interview process as fast as I could hoping to let the program know which enough notice the could replace me. Unfortunately, the hiring process took longer than expected and I didn’t get the official offer until after the scramble happened. (I wanted an official offer prior to telling the program).

When I called my new RPD to tell them it was very hard and they were not happy. Things to keep in mind 1) When you tell them, they will be responding in a moment of confusion and a bit of panic (depending how much the program relies on its resident it can change their operating parameters). Give them grace and time to process what you’ve had weeks or months to process. 2) You cannot control how they respond and react. I tried extremely hard to keep a good relationship and not burn bridges. I offered to try and be a liaison and work to create a rotation for future residents to explore the new location I was working at. They were not happy and cut communications with me and when I’ve seen them at conferences it’s been uncomfortable. 3) you have to do what’s best for you. If this is truly your dream job and is something you can see yourself staying at for 4-5 years then take the opportunity! The PGY2 is to help you get a job you will be happy with but if you already have that- congratulations!

I went to this new job and have been there for a year and am extremely happy with my decision! The hospital I’m at doesn’t have a lot of turn over because the culture is incredible and I could see myself here for 5-10 years. Make sure this is a place you don’t see yourself leaving anytime soon.
